Ingredients

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Preheat oven to 350°F and line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
  2. Step 2: In a large bowl, use an electric mixer to cream together 1 cup softened unsalted butter and 3/4 cup granulated sugar until light and fluffy, about 3 minutes.
  3. Step 3: Beat in 1 tsp vanilla extract until combined.
  4. Step 4: Gradually add 1 3/4 cups all-purpose flour, mixing on low speed until just incorporated.
  5. Step 5: Fold in 1 cup chopped toasted pecans evenly throughout the dough.
  6. Step 6: Scoop tablespoon-sized portions of dough onto the prepared baking sheets, spacing about 2 inches apart.
  7. Step 7: Bake for 12-14 minutes until edges are lightly golden and centers are set.
  8. Step 8: Let cookies cool on the baking sheet for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.

How do I store leftover Five-Ingredient Butter Pecan Cookies?

Cool fully before storing. Most baked desserts keep at room temperature in an airtight container for 2–3 days, or in the fridge for up to 5 days. Cream- or custard-based desserts must go in the fridge within 2 hours; reheat gently or serve cold per the recipe.
